Transaction 425fa890632625b8aea05a7662ffaf18be132a99772cf1db8669342151111c9c

1 Input
2 Outputs
  • 425fa890632625b8aea05a7662ffaf18be132a99772cf1db8669342151111c9c:0
  • value  124766673565
    address  2N8WegsxRAzLPS4bnbCXTqJwZM1Lj7c7mwB
  • 425fa890632625b8aea05a7662ffaf18be132a99772cf1db8669342151111c9c:1
  • value  8610063
    address  2NBMEX7GA5m7GjkX24QtCbnB4zgV3EYeAn5